Broker Overview

  Established in 2022, Unifi Forex is operated by Unifi Capital Australia Pty Ltd and claims to be based in Australia. However, it lacks a valid regulatory license from any recognized authority, which raises concerns about the safety of client funds. Unifi Forex offers the widely-used MetaTrader 5 platform, allowing traders to access a variety of assets, including forex pairs, cryptocurrencies, commodities, indices, and stocks.

  

Detailed Analysis

  

Regulatory Status

  Unifi Forex operates without any regulatory oversight from recognized financial authorities, such as the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C). This lack of regulation is a significant concern, as it means that the broker is not subject to the same standards and protections as regulated entities. According to sources, Unifi Forex has falsely claimed to be regulated, which is a major red flag for potential traders (The Forex Review).

  

Deposit/Withdrawal Methods

  Unifi Forex primarily accepts cryptocurrency deposits, particularly USD Tether, which is a common practice among unregulated brokers. The minimum deposit is reported to be as low as $5, but some sources indicate that actual funding might require $50 (The Forex Review). Withdrawals can be challenging, with many users reporting high fees and complications when attempting to access their funds.

  

Minimum Deposit

  The minimum deposit varies according to the account type chosen. For the standard account, it is reported to be $5, while the zero account requires a minimum of $1,000 and the pro account $10,000. However, there are inconsistencies in the information provided on the website, which adds to the confusion (WikiBit).

  

Bonuses/Promotions

  There is little to no information on any bonuses or promotional offers from Unifi Forex. The absence of such incentives may be a drawback for traders seeking additional value from their trading experience.

  

Tradable Asset Classes

  Unifi Forex offers a range of tradable assets, including forex pairs, cryptocurrencies, commodities, indices, and stocks. While the variety is commendable, the number of available instruments is relatively limited compared to other regulated brokers that can offer thousands of options (The Forex Review).

  

Costs (Spreads, Fees, Commissions)

  The trading costs at Unifi Forex are not particularly competitive. The spreads for major pairs like EUR/USD are reported to start at around 2 pips, which is higher than many regulated brokers (The Forex Review). Additionally, the lack of transparency regarding fees and commissions can lead to unexpected costs for traders.

  

Leverage

  Unifi Forex offers high leverage ratios, reportedly up to 1:500 for forex trading. However, such high leverage is considered risky and is banned in many jurisdictions, including Australia. This further underscores the broker's questionable regulatory status (The Forex Review).

  

Allowed Trading Platforms

  Unifi Forex provides access to the MetaTrader 5 platform, which is known for its robust features and user-friendly interface. However, the broker also mentions another platform called Vertex, which lacks detailed information and reviews (WikiBit).

  

Restricted Regions

  While specific details about restricted regions are not extensively covered, the unregulated nature of Unifi Forex suggests that traders from various jurisdictions should exercise caution. The lack of regulatory approval means that traders may not have access to the same protections as they would with a licensed broker.

  

Available Customer Support Languages

  Customer support at Unifi Forex is primarily offered in English. However, reviews indicate that response times can be slow, and users have reported difficulties in resolving issues (WikiBit).
